Japewiella
''Japewiella'' is a genus of lichen in the family Lecanoraceae. It was circumscribed in 2000 by German botanist and lichenologist Christian Printzen as a segregate of the genus '' Japewia''. The genus name of ''Japewia'' was in honour of Peter Wilfrid James (1930 - 2014), who was an English botanist (Mycology and Lichenology). The genus was circumscribed by Christian Printzen in Bryologist vol.102 on page 715 in 1999. The type, '' Japewiella carrollii'', is an oceanic species that occurs in maritime regions of Europe and Macaronesia. Description ''Japewiella'' species are crust lichens that grow on bark. They are characterized by their biatorine apothecia, thick-walled, simple ascospores, eight-spored asci with a conspicuous ''masse axiale'' (similar to asci found in members of genus ''Lecidella''). Japewiella Dollypartoniana
''Japewiella dollypartoniana'' is a species of crustose lichen in the family Lecanoraceae. It is widely distributed in the Appalachian Mountains of eastern North America, and has also been reported from Ontario, Canada. The lichen grows on tree branches and sapling and shrub stems at middle to high elevations. Taxonomy The lichen was formally described as a new species in 2015 by Jessica Allen and James Lendemer. The type specimen was found in the Joyce Kilmer-Slickrock Wilderness area of Nantahala National Forest in North Carolina. Here it was found growing on an exposed rock in a heath bald community dominated by ericaceous shrubs such as ''Rhododendron'', '' Vaccinium'', and '' Kalmia'', at an altitude of . The specific epithet honors Dolly Parton, described by the authors as "one of the most famous country singers of all time and a native of the southern Appalachians". Lecanoraceae
The Lecanoraceae are a family of lichenized fungi in the order Lecanorales. Species of this family have a widespread distribution. Taxonomy Lecanoraceae was circumscribed by German lichenologist Gustav Wilhelm Körber in 1855. Lecidella
''Lecidella'' is a genus of crustose lichens in the family Lecanoraceae. Taxonomy ''Lecidella'' was circumscribed by German lichenologist Gustav Wilhelm Körber in 1855. It was not widely used until more than a century later, when Hannes Hertel recognized it first as a subgenus of ''Lecidea'', and then a couple of year after as a distinct genus. A phylogenetic analysis of the genus using 11 species (mostly from China) found that ''Lecidella'' species fall into three major clades, which were proposed as three informal groups: ''Lecidella stigmatea'' group, ''L. elaeochroma'' group and'' L. enteroleucella'' group. Description ''Lecidella'' species have a thallus that is crustose, and biatorine, meaning that it resembles the genus '' Biatora''–having a proper exciple, which is not coal-black, but coloured or blackening. Ascus
An ascus (; ) is the sexual spore-bearing cell produced in ascomycete fungi. Each ascus usually contains eight ascospores (or octad), produced by meiosis followed, in most species, by a mitotic cell division. However, asci in some genera or species can occur in numbers of one (e.g. ''Monosporascus cannonballus''), two, four, or multiples of four. In a few cases, the ascospores can bud off conidia that may fill the asci (e.g. ''Tympanis'') with hundreds of conidia, or the ascospores may fragment, e.g. some ''Cordyceps'', also filling the asci with smaller cells. Ascospores are nonmotile, usually single celled, but not infrequently may be coenocytic (lacking a septum), and in some cases coenocytic in multiple planes. Mitotic divisions within the developing spores populate each resulting cell in septate ascospores with nuclei. Appalachian Mountains
The Appalachian Mountains, often called the Appalachians, (french: Appalaches), are a system of mountains in eastern to northeastern North America. The Appalachians first formed roughly 480 million years ago during the Ordovician Period. They once reached elevations similar to those of the Alps and the Rocky Mountains before experiencing natural erosion. The Appalachian chain is a barrier to east–west travel, as it forms a series of alternating ridgelines and valleys oriented in opposition to most highways and railroads running east–west. Definitions vary on the precise boundaries of the Appalachians.
